Mary Karen Simpson was a judge on the Sixteenth Circuit Court (3rd Subcircuit) of Illinois. She was elected in 2010 and retired in 2014.[1][2][3][4]
2010 election
- See also: Illinois judicial elections, 2010
Simpson ran unopposed and was elected with 100% of the vote.[5]
